The Major Regulators in Australian Online Casino Industry
Australia’s online casino landscape is governed by several regional regulators, each tasked with ensuring the integrity and fairness of online gambling. Among the most prominent are:
- Northern Territory Racing Commission (NTRC): Known for its stringent policies, the NTRC oversees a number of online casinos, ensuring they meet high standards of operation.
- Victorian Commission for Gambling and Liquor Regulation (VCGLR): This body is responsible for regulating both land-based and online casinos in Victoria, demanding transparency from operators.
-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A): Although not a traditional regulator, the ACMA enforces the Interactive Gambling Act, which influences online casino operations across the nation.
These regulators diligently monitor online casinos, implement regulations, and ensure that all operators maintain ethical and responsible gambling practices. These agencies set the benchmark for online gaming conduct, making them indispensable to the industry.
The Role of Licensing in Ensuring Fair Play
Licensing is a crucial component in the online gambling industry, serving as a quality assurance marker for players. Australian regulators examine numerous facets of online casinos before granting licenses:
- Financial Stability: Operators must prove they have the financial backing to fulfill player payouts.
- Game Fairness: Independent audits are required to ensure all games operate fairly and randomly.
- Security Protocols: Casinos must demonstrate robust cybersecurity measures to protect player data.
A license from an Australian regulator not only boosts a casino’s credibility but also assures players of a safe and fair gaming environment.

Challenges Faced by Australian Online Casino Regulators
Despite their success, Australian regulators face an array of challenges. One significant issue is the rise of unregulated offshore casinos, which pose risks to Australian players due to a lack of oversight. Moreover, staying ahead of technological advancements presents a continuous challenge, requiring regulators to frequently update their frameworks to address new developments in the industry effectively.
Furthermore, balancing regulatory demands while fostering a competitive market is an ongoing task. Maintaining stringent regulations without stifling innovation or reducing the attractiveness of the market for operators requires a strategic approach that Australian regulators consistently strive to master.
